Chiria is a census town in Pashchimi Singhbhum district in the state of Jharkhand, India. India 's largest iron ore mine with reserves of 2,000 million tonnes of iron ore is located here.
Population: 3,945
Latitude: 22° 18' 41.18" N
Longitude: 85° 16' 32.02" E
